The surname Matwiejszyn is a unique and rare surname that has origins in Poland. With an incidence of 164 in Poland, this surname has a significant presence in the country. The surname also has a small presence in other countries such as England, Argentina, and Brazil.
The surname Matwiejszyn is derived from the given name Matwiej, which is a Polish variant of the name Matthew. The suffix -szyn is a common suffix used in Polish surnames, indicating "son of" or "descendant of." Therefore, Matwiejszyn can be translated to mean "son of Matthew."
